This Paraprofessional role offers a dynamic opportunity to work closely with students, either individually or in small groups, reinforcing lessons, aiding with assignments, and contributing to the children's growth and development

Responsibilities
- Assisting licensed staff in the classroom
- Aid students in meeting their individualized education plan (IEP)
- Maintain a classroom environment that is conducive to learning and de-escalate behaviors
- Work with individuals and/or small groups when activities and assignments are presented
- Provides support for students in crisis
- Utilize a variety of learning methods to enhance the student's learning experiences and support them as needed.

Required Qualifications
- High school diploma obtained in the United States
- 6+ months experience supporting people with special needs (in any capacity), ideally child-focused experience
- Applicants must have professional proficiency in English
- US Work Authorization - Zen Educate cannot provide sponsorship for an employment visa or relocation assistance at this time

Physical Requirements:
- Comfortable being on your feet and moving around the classroom throughout the day
- Able to lift up to 20 lbs and safely assist students when needed (kneeling, bending, quick response)
- Additional physical requirements may be requested during your application process

Preferred Qualifications / Experience
- Experience working in special education, particularly with moderate to severe behaviors
- Experience with personal care tasks, like diapering and toileting
- Experience handling unexpected behaviour, such as hitting and biting
- Comfortable with eloping
- Experience with behaviour strategies and methodologies
- Experience in collecting data and following BI plan
- Associate's degree or higher (obtained in the US or US equivalency check completed)
- Pro-Act training
- Certification in CPR and First Aid
